Company Overview
Impression Technologies Limited is listed at the official companies registry as in Liquidation Private Limited Company. The company was incorporated on Friday 30 March 2012, so this is a well established company. Impression Technologies Limited has been in business for 14 years. The accounts status is unaudited abridged and the accounts are next due on Monday 30 September 2024.
